Comprehending Indoor Volleyball Participant Positions: Roles and Responsibilities about the Courtroom

Indoor volleyball is a fast-paced, strategic sport that relies seriously on teamwork, coordination, and precise execution. Just about every participant about the court has a specific posture with exceptional roles and obligations that contribute to the workforce’s Total functionality. Knowing these positions is key to appreciating how a volleyball staff functions, both offensively and defensively. Below’s a breakdown in the 6 principal participant positions in indoor volleyball.

1. Outside the house Hitter (Still left Facet Hitter)
The surface hitter is commonly deemed probably the most multipurpose player to the group. Positioned to the front still left facet on the court docket, this player is responsible for attacking, blocking, and enjoying protection within the back again row. Outside the house hitters receive a greater part of your sets and are typically sturdy passers, earning them vital in both equally offense and provide-receive formations. Their all-close to skillset would make them a dependable scoring threat.

2. Opposite Hitter (Appropriate Aspect Hitter)
Reverse hitters Enjoy on the front correct side in the courtroom, specifically reverse the setter in rotation. This situation focuses totally on attacking and blocking, significantly against the opposing team’s outside hitters. They usually don't take part in serve-obtain but are essential for countering another group’s best attackers. A powerful opposite hitter provides equilibrium and extra offensive firepower for his or her crew.

3. Center Blocker (Center Hitter)
Positioned at the center in the front row, the center blocker could be the staff’s 1st line of defense. Their Main job is to dam opposing hitters, In particular swift attacks from the center of The web. Offensively, they execute quick-paced assaults often known as “swift sets” and therefore are key to functioning advanced plays. This posture calls for fast reflexes, potent jumping ability, and great timing.

4. Setter
The setter is commonly called the “quarterback” of the staff. This participant is liable for establishing the offense by offering correct and strategic sets into the hitters. The setter have to make break up-second selections about which teammate to established determined by the protection’s formation along with the team’s Engage in strategy. Excellent setters have fantastic communication techniques, specific hand placement, and the chance to examine the opposing workforce’s blockers.

5. Libero
The libero can be a defensive professional who wears a different-colored jersey and cannot attack ALO789 or provide (for most leagues). Positioned in the back row, the libero is answerable for acquiring serves, digging opponent assaults, and enhancing the group’s Total ball Command. They can substitute freely for just about any back again-row player, producing them A vital part of provide-get and defense. Even with not scoring factors specifically, liberos Enjoy an important purpose in sustaining rallies and setting up offense within the backcourt.

six. Defensive Expert
Just like the libero, a defensive expert focuses on passing and digging but would not use a contrasting jersey and it has restricted substitutions. They may change entrance-row gamers once the rotation shifts to defense. While much less common than other roles, a defensive professional provides depth to some team’s defensive abilities.

Just about every volleyball placement has a distinct purpose, and achievements over the courtroom relies over the harmony involving all six roles. Understanding these positions deepens appreciation with the sport and highlights the importance of tactic, ability, and teamwork in indoor volleyball.
